Why “No Wagering” Bingo is a Lifesaver for Low Rollers

Let me explain it simply. Normal bingo sites give you a bonus. You think you are rich. Then you read the terms: “Wager your bonus 40x before withdrawal.” So your £5 freebie suddenly requires you to bet £200. If you are like me, on a budget, that is impossible. It locks your cash away.

No wagering means what you win is yours. Instantly. It’s rare in this industry, but a few real brands have started offering it. PlayOJO was a pioneer here, calling it “OJOplus”. They still don’t have wagering requirements on their free spins or bingo bonuses. It is a breath of fresh air. What Does “No Wagering” Actually Mean for UK Players in 2026?

It means what you win is yours. Period. If you stake £5 on a 90-ball game and hit a full house for £25, that £25 is cash. You can withdraw it instantly (or keep playing). There is no 35x requirement hidden in the terms. It sounds too good to be true, but a few UKGC-licensed brands have actually committed to this model full-time.

But here is the catch. I found a couple of sites that claim “no wagering” but then attach a max cashout limit. For example, one site I looked at gave a £10 bingo bonus with 0x wagering. Great. But the max cashout was only £50. So if you somehow hit a big win, you only get £50. Read the tiny text.

How to Spot a Fake “No Wagering” Offer

Not everything that glitters is gold. I saw a site last month advertising “No Wagering Bingo!” in huge letters. I clicked the T&Cs. It said: “Winnings from free spins awarded must be wagered 10x before withdrawal.” That is not no wagering. That is deception.

Here is my quick check list.

  • Look for the phrase “cash” or “real cash” in the promotion. Not “bonus credit”.
  • Check the max cashout. If it says “Max cashout £100”, you are capped.
  • See if the game weightings are listed. If they exclude table games, it is a red flag for a “no wagering” claim.
  • Stick to UKGC licensed sites. They are stricter. MGA sites sometimes play fast and loose with definitions.
